Salt la continut

Welcome to Gamerii Romania @ Since 2012
Register now to gain access to all of our features. Once registered and logged in, you will be able to create topics, post replies to existing threads, give reputation to your fellow members, get your own private messenger, post status updates, manage your profile and so much more. If you already have an account, login here - otherwise create an account for free today!
Fotografie

MySQL - Notiuni de baza


  • Topic inchis Acest topic e inchis
1 reply to this topic

NemeSyS

NemeSyS

    Fost Administrator

  • Pip
  •   Group:
    Premium
  •   Posts:
    1337
  •   Member Number:
    4033
  •   Inregistrat:
    30-June 17
  •   Reputation:
    64
    • Time Online: 32d 1h 11m 47s

    @Mention
    Bazele de date sunt folosite pentru stocarea informatiilor in vederea furnizarii ulterioare in functie de solicitarea primita.
    MySQL este un sistem de baze de date functional independent.
    In PHP exista functii pentru toate operatiile executate asupra bazelor de date MySQL.
    Administrarea MySQL se poate face din linie de comanda sau folosind browserul si accesand aplicatia numita PHPMyAdmin scrisa in PHP.
    Cele mai uzuale operatii cu bazele de date sunt:
    Comanda Semnificatie CREATE creaza o baza de date sau un tabel DROP sterge o baza de date sau un tabel INSERT adauga inregistrari intr-un tabel DELETE sterge inregistrari dintr-un tabel UPDATE updateaza inregistrarile dintr-un tabel SELECT selecteaza un tabel ALTER alterarea unui tabel
    In MySQL spatiul alocat pe discul serverului este functie de tipul de date. Cateva din tipurile de date folosite in bazele de date MySQL sunt:
    Tip Semnificatie   int() numar intreg 32 biti bigint() numar intreg 64 biti tinyint() numar intreg (-128 la 127 sau 0 la 255) 8 biti mediumint() numar intreg 24 biti smallint() numar intreg 16 biti char() sectiune cu lungime fixa de la 0 la 255 caractere varchar() sectiune cu lungime variabila de la 0 la 255 caractere float() numar mic cu virgula flotanta double numar mare cu virgula flotanta text sir cu maximum 65535 caractere date() data in format YYYY-MM-DD date data in format YYYY-MM-DD HH:MM:SS time ora in format HH:MM:SS
    Pentru ca baza de date sa fuctioneze mai bine coloanelor li s-au adaugat modificatori de coloana.
    Tipul de date intregi incep de la valori negative la pozitive. Daca se adauga optiunea UNSIGNED, care este un modificator de coloana, nu vor mai fi valori negative ci vor incepe de la 0.
    Alti modificatori sunt:
    AUTO_INCREMENT functioneaza cu orice tip intreg. La fiecare rand nou adaugat in baza de date numarul asociat va fi incrementat.
    NULL inseamna fara valoare (diferit de spatiu sau zero).
    NOT NULL inseamna ca orice inregistrare va fi considerata ceva.
    PRIMARY KEY este rolul primei coloane din tabel, totodata reprezentand elementul de referinta pentru fiecare linie.


    BlackEye

    BlackEye

      Administrator Gamerii.Ro | Moderator

    • Pip
  •   Group:
    Fondator
  •   Posts:
    286
  •   Member Number:
    3676
  •   Inregistrat:
    01-September 16
  •   Reputation:
    63
    • Time Online: 10d 12h 31m 19s

    @Mention

    :tc: topic vechi.


    "%20alt=





    0 useri citesc topicul

    0 membri, 0 vizitatori, 0 utilizatori anonimi

    Theme